The global Non-combustible Plate market is projected to grow from US$ 21140 million in 2024 to US$ 35730 million by 2031, at a CAGR of 7.9% (2025-2031), driven by critical product segments and diverse end‑use applications, while evolving U.S. tariff policies introduce trade‑cost volatility and supply‑chain uncertainty.
A non-combustible plate is used as interior finishing materials, such as ceilings, columns, and walls, to prevent fires, particularly in their early stages. It is classified as a "fireproof material." Although the material itself absorbs heat, it is characterized by its slow ignition. Specifically, it is a building material that does not ignite for at least 20 minutes after the onset of heating.
Typical non-combustible plates include gypsum plate and calcium silicate plate. A Gypsum board, also known as a plasterboard, is an interior board. Materials such as cloth are applied over this board for finishing. While it is embedded inside and not visible, it is a common material used in various interior parts of a building. However, it is not suitable for use around water, as its thermal insulation is compromised when wet. Silica board, composed of siliceous raw materials, is inherently noncombustible. It differs from gypsum board in its water resistance. The silica board consists of siliceous material, calcareous material, and reinforcing fiber. It is particularly useful in wet and humid areas where gypsum board is less effective. Additionally, it is used in outdoor areas, although not directly exposed to rain.
Non-combustible plates are widely used in buildings to minimize fire damage. They are particularly prevalent in areas with a high potential for fire spread, such as walls, columns, and ceilings. Gypsum board, for instance, is extensively used, except in areas subject to direct water contact, like bathrooms and sinks.
